I was talking specifically about the price of the Elcan Specter sight by itself...pretty pricey to say the least....:confused:

I carried one on my last deployment and loved it. I like being able to switch between 1x and 4x with the throw of a single lever (without needing two separate dohickies on top of my rifle) when I'm going in and out of villages (where I might need close up) and the valleys they're in (where I might need to engage someone at 500m trying to ambush me on the ridgeline).

I liked the Elcan a lot better than the ACOG I carried on my first deployment and the EOTech I had on my second one (and all of those better than the Aimpoint CCOs my unit currently uses lol)

Um, whichever the standard issue Trijicon ACOG 4x32 was back in 2008! :p Looking at their website, I'd say it's most likely the TA01NSN https://www.trijicon.com/na_en/products/product3.php?pid=TA01NSN
This is the Elcan I deployed with in 2011: ELCAN Specter DR 1-4x http://www.raytheon.com/capabilities/products/dualrole_ws/

As a straight, simple scope, yes the ACOG is a great piece, I'd kinda rather have one over my currently issued CCO. Problem is that I d9nt like them for close up stuff, not when I can have an Elcan and throw a lever and see what I'm looking at close up in a compound, but then when I have to engage some *** hole 300m away down the road on a balconey, I can rapidly go into 4x and aim and engage, then go back and clear rooms in the next compound all in one sight. That's why I really, really, really wanna Elcan lol

Glock Blue Label is the way to go. Major discount for EMS, Fire, LEO, ext. Also blue label comes with three mags. The only difference is the label on the box is blue showing its discounted for the program. Most Glock dealers have them in stock but won't tell you about it unless you ask cause they don't make money on the blue label program.
